Understanding Mental Health Assessments
A mental health assessment is an organized technique to evaluate a person's mental, psychological, and mental state. These assessments often notify diagnosis, treatment preparation, and monitoring progress in time. While the specifics may vary depending on the expert, settings, and specific requirements, the general function remains constant: to acquire a comprehensive understanding of a person's mental health.
Significance of Mental Health Assessments
Mental health assessments serve several basic purposes:

Mental health assessments must consist of a number of key components to guarantee a holistic approach:
1. Clinical Interview
An extensive clinical interview is typically the primary step in any mental health assessment. This includes event info about the person's history, existing scenario, and mental health symptoms. Important elements to cover consist of:
Presenting Issues: What brings the specific to look for aid?History of Mental Health: Any previous diagnoses, treatments, or hospitalizations?Family and Social History: Examining family background and social impacts.Substance Use: Assessing any history of drug or alcohol usage.2. Standardized Assessment Tools
There exist numerous standardized instruments that can assist in the assessment:
ToolFunctionBeck Depression InventoryMeasures the severity of depression.Generalized Anxiety Disorder 7 (GAD-7)Screens for generalized anxiety disorder.Patient Health Questionnaire (PHQ-9)Assesses depression signs over the past 2 weeks.Mini-Mental State Examination (MMSE)Evaluates cognitive problems.
These tools supply measurable information that can enhance the understanding of the person's mental health status.
3. Observational Assessment
Observation can be an essential part of the assessment process. Professionals might observe:
Non-verbal Behavior: Body language, eye contact, and posture.Emotional Responses: Reactions to questions or topics can provide insight into present psychological states.Cognitive Functioning: How a private thinks and interacts can be observed during interactions.4. Physical Health Assessment
Mental health can not be effectively examined without considering physical health. A comprehensive physical assessment can help recognize any medical conditions that could contribute to mental health problems. This might include:

Mental health assessments can be performed by a variety of specialists, including psychologists, psychiatrists, clinical social workers, and accredited therapists.
For how long does a mental health assessment take?
The period of a mental health assessment can differ commonly, typically from one hour to numerous hours, depending upon the intricacy of the case and the depth of info needed.
Are assessments private?
Yes, mental health assessments are confidential. Nevertheless, there are certain legal and ethical exceptions, specifically if the individual postures a danger to themselves or others.
Is a mental health assessment needed for everybody looking for aid?
Not everybody needs an assessment. Some individuals may take advantage of fast screenings, while others with more complicated needs might require comprehensive examinations.
Can assessments be carried out online?
Yes, lots of mental health assessments can now be administered digitally, offering greater ease of access. Nevertheless, in-person assessments might be essential for a more thorough evaluation.
